Latest Git still freezes AGP [GeForce 7600 GS]

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]


Just a ping here concerning the "nVidia Corporation G73 [GeForce 7600 GS]" and
AGP issues.


I still have to use agpmode=0 (aka kernel parameter nouveau.agpmode=0) to
avoid kernel (framebuffer) freezes when loading drm/nouveau drivers.


My next task will be to get KDB working to hopefully get a backtrace.  Or is it
futile at this point?  Using KGDB, I think stalls the serial bus and, the info
I earlier collected showed nothing relevant to this or to any indication of a
kernel panic.
